ONE OF GLAMOUR'S BEST BOOKS OF THE YEAR

"This masterful novel combines readable, lyrical prose with a compelling plot and complex characters. . . . Wisdom weaves these tangled threads with overarching themes of how the patriarchy controls womens minds and bodies." Booklist (Starred Review)

The acclaimed author of We Can Only Save Ourselves returns with an urgent and unsettling story that journeys into the heart of religious fanaticism and cult behavior as it probes one womans struggle to define life on her own terms.

Here comes trouble, Rosemarys high school English teacher used to say whenever he saw her. Rosemary has often felt like trouble, and now at thirty-two, her marriage to her college sweetheart, Paul, is crumbling. In a last-ditch attempt to restore it, she agrees to give herself over to a newly formed Christian sect in central Texas, run by charismatic young pastor Papa Jake.

While Paul acclimates quickly to the small town of Dawson and the churchs insistence on a strict set of puritanical rules, Rosemary struggles to fit in. She finds purpose only when shes called upon to help Julie, a new mother in the community, who is feeling isolated and lost.

Then the community is rocked by a series of fires which take some church members homes and nearly take their lives, but which Papa Jake says are holy and a representation of Gods will.

As the fires spread, and Julie is betrayed in a terrible way, Rosemary begins to question the reality of her life, and wonders if trouble will always find heror if shell ever be able to outrun it.
